Vidanta Vallarta Course (Greg Norman)
MX

The Vidanta Vallarta Course sits within the expansive Vidanta resort complex along Mexico's Pacific coast in Nuevo Vallarta, Nayarit, just north of Puerto Vallarta. Designed by Greg Norman and opened in the early 2010s, the course occupies relatively flat terrain characteristic of the coastal plain, with the layout incorporating water features, tropical vegetation, and views toward the Sierra Madre mountains inland and glimpses of Banderas Bay. The design reflects Norman's preference for strategic bunkering and risk-reward opportunities, adapted here to the resort setting and tropical climate. The routing works through the resort property with holes framed by palm trees, native vegetation, and landscaped areas that separate fairways from the surrounding development. Water comes into play on several holes, both as natural features and constructed lakes that add strategic interest to approach shots and create visual definition. The course serves primarily resort guests and members of the Vidanta club system, offering a championship-length layout that accommodates a range of skill levels while providing enough challenge for accomplished players. As part of a large-scale resort destination, the course integrates with Vidanta's broader amenities including hotels, restaurants, and recreational facilities. The setting provides a tropical golf experience distinct from the desert courses found elsewhere in Mexico, with the coastal climate and lush landscaping creating a different aesthetic and playing environment. The course represents one of several Norman designs in Mexico and contributes to the region's golf tourism infrastructure along the Riviera Nayarit.
Got the opportunity to play the Greg Norman course at Vidanta recently on vacation. First time playing a course that is a PGA tour stop. Course condition was superb, tight fairways and firm greens, green speeds were fast. Caddy was knowledge about the course and very helpful when reading greens, which I was playing on different grass than I’m used to. Views of the Sierra Madres are in the background on the majority of the course. As a non-resort member or guest, green fees are slightly unreasonable, definitely a better deal being with a member of the resort. Would happily play it again!
